Clarkson/Leigh lost against Lakeview back in December of 2023 and unfortunately they wound up with the same result on Friday. The game between the Clarkson/Leigh Patriots and the Lakeview Vikings didn't end well, with the Clarkson/Leigh Patriots falling 53-38. While losing is never fun, the Patriots can't take it too hard given the team's big disadvantage in MaxPreps' Nebraska basketball rankings (they are ranked 215th, while the Vikings are ranked 94th).
Clarkson/Leigh's defeat came despite a true team effort from the offense, with many players turning in solid performances. Perhaps the best among them was Kyle McMullin, who posted 13 points and six rebounds. The team also got some help courtesy of Korbin Lemburg, who went 7 of 14 on his way to 17 points.
Clarkson/Leigh's loss was their 14th straight on the road dating back to last season, which dropped their record down to 2-8. As for Lakeview, their win ended a three-game drought at home and bumped them up to 6-3.
Clarkson/Leigh will face off against Aquinas at 7:30 p.m. on Tuesday. As for Lakeview, they will square off against Douglas County West on Thursday.
